macVlanConfigTable

TPLINK-MAC-VLAN-MIB · .1.3.6.1.4.1.11863.6.15.1.1.1

Object

table
MAC VLAN (Virtual Local Area Network) is the way to classify the 
VLANs based on MAC Address. A MAC address is relative to a single 
VLAN ID. The untagged packets and the priority-tagged packets coming 
from the MAC address will be tagged with this VLAN ID.
